:ADVB ADVB Associação dos Dirigentes de Vendas e Marketing do Brasil ) announced today that it had raised approximately $3,667,000 in the private placement of its subordinated convertible pay-in-kind notes during approximately two months ended June 14, 2002.

The convertible notes bear interest at 11% per year payable in cash or additional convertible debt, and are convertible into shares of Company Common Stock at a conversion price of $0.25 per share, subject to certain anti-dilution rights. The convertible notes were placed in two series with the first maturing on September 30, 2004, of which approximately $1,147,000 was placed, and the second maturing on June 1, 2006, of which approximately $2,520,000 was placed during June 2002.

Commenting on this announcement, Mr. Edmond Buccellato, President and Chief Executive Officer, stated "This infusion of capital, combined with the strength of our intellectual property, will allow us to implement our business plan regarding the conduct of clinical trials in the U.S."

As a result of proceeds raised from the placement of its convertible debt during the month of June, 2002, the Company has decided to file for Phase I Investigational New Drug Applications (IND's) with the US Food and Drug Administration for two specific autoimmune diseases Autoimmune diseases

. An IND may be submitted for one or more phases of an investigation.

The clinical investigation of a previously untested drug is generally divided into three phases. Phase I, the initial phase, includes the initial introduction of an investigational new drug into humans. Phase I studies are typically closely monitored and may be conducted in patients or normal volunteer subjects.
